Transitioning houseplants to outdoors

It is a little early to consider moving your houseplants outside for the summer, but you can start to get them acclimated to outside conditions. Start placing them on the patio during the day. Give them shade to start. Bring them inside at night. Once we’re past our frost-free date you’ll be ready to go.
